Examples: Input: [(1, 0), (2, 1), (3, 6), (-5, 2), (1, -4)], K = 3Output: [(1, 0), (2, 1), (1, -4)]Explanation:Square of Distances of points from origin are(1, 0) : 1(2, 1) : 5(3, 6) : 45(-5, 2) : 29(1, -4) : 17Hence for K = 3, the closest 3 points are (1, 0), (2, 1) & (1, -4).Input: [(1, 3), (-2, 2)], K = 1Output: [(-2, 2)]Explanation:Square of Distances of points from origin are(1, 3) : 10(-2, 2) : 8Hence for K = 1, the closest point is (-2, 2). Approach using sorting based on distance: This approach is explained in this article.Approach using Priority Queue for comparison: To solve the problem mentioned above, the main idea is to store the coordinates of the point in a priority queue of pairs, according to the distance of the point from the origin.
